Jagatsinghpur: To avenge the death of her pet goat, a woman allegedly poisoned about 25 crows, 20 dogs and three cats at Bakharpur village under Tirtol police limits of Odisha’s Jagatsinghpur district.
An FIR has been filed against the accused, Dukhi Barik (45). While Tirtol police have begun a probe, no arrest has been made yet so far.
According to sources, Dukhi’s goat was attacked by a stray dog on Monday which led to its death. Unable to bear the loss, an enraged Barik allegedly added poison to food and used it as a bait to attract birds and animals in the vicinity. Bodies of crows, dogs and cats were found scattered across Chatra Math, Bakharpur, Amirpur and other nearby localities on Tuesday morning sending shockwaves in the area.
The villagers suspect that she had strewn dead goat’s meat mixed with poison. “We saw her infuriated after her pet was attacked and it is her handiwork which will be proved after investigation,” said Narayan Nanda, who lodged a complaint against her at Tirtol police station.
Inspector-in-charge (IIC) Abhimanyu Nayak told the media that the dead animals had been sent to the local veterinary hospital for postmortem.
